At least 47 militants were killed in rebel-on-rebel battles in a contested town in Syria’s northern province of Aleppo on Saturday, a monitor group reported.

The IS advances came despite an agreement between Turkey and the United States to work on the establishment of an IS-free zone in northern Aleppo.

In August, Marea was exposed to a chemical attack by militants of the Islamic State, who have been combatting rebel fighters in the vicinity of the town for months.

Islamic State said late on Friday it had waged a fresh assault on Marea, killing “dozens” of Syrian rebels fighting against it.

Twenty Islamist and other rebel fighters were killed in the clashes in Aleppo province throughout Friday, along with 27 IS jihadists, the Britain-based Syrian Observatory for Human Rights said.

IS holds large swathes of territory across Syria and Iraq, and has advanced in other areas of Syria in recent months.
